## FAQ: Why do Tandemly calendar events appear twice after a sync conflict?

When a Tandemly user edits an event offline while a Quillboard delegate edits the same event, the merge service keeps both copies rather than guessing intent. Support can resolve this by opening the conflict queue, selecting the canonical copy, and purging the duplicate. If the queue itself is locked, you'll need to unseal it using the recovery passphrase provided below.

strongbox words: prawyn-fenmir

## Authentication

Heads up: the nightly reindex job (`reindex_nightly.py`) talks to the Lanternfish search cluster, and that cluster won't accept anonymous writes anymore — we locked it down last sprint. The job now authenticates as the `reindex-runner` service identity against Corvid Gateway, and the token is injected via the `LF_INDEX_TOKEN` env var in the scheduler config. Nothing clever going on, just a bearer header on every batch request. For review purposes, the staging credential currently in use is listed below.

service key, kadug-kadup: kto15_rN23XLAYImmZgrJ

**Ticket: Circuit breaker drift on Farrow upstream**

The circuit breaker guarding calls to the Farrow pricing API has drifted between environments: staging trips after 5 failures, production after 20. This makes incident behavior hard to predict for anyone new on rotation. We should align all environments to the agreed settings, which are the following.

deployment values, yadug-bawif:
[framir]
team = pelox
access_code = ac_a38ab2
owner = tamion.julael
host = framir.tolvaqlabs.test
port = 11211
peer = tammir.zemvargrid.local
salt = 2215ef03
pin = 1541

Subject: Handover — SDK parity work

Hi Verla,

As discussed, I'm passing you the parity tracking for the Quillbase client SDKs. The Go SDK now matches the Python one except for batch upserts, which land next sprint. The security reviewer asked us to document every credential path the SDKs touch, so I've tagged those tables in the schema notes. For the parity-test database, connect using the string below.

warehouse DSN: mssql://rusdor_svc:0FSWCn9@db-951a.paliqforge.local:5432/ulawyn